The Stability Analysis For General BAM Nerual Networks With Delays

The focus of this thesis is to study the global asymptotic stability,global ex-ponential stability of general BAM neural networks with delays,and the continuity of equilibrium point which dependent on the parameters.The main points are or-ganized as follows:Firstly, the background and the motivation for the study of general BAM neural networks with delays are presented,and some general research methods are introduced in brief.And it must be pointed out that we just require that activation function is Lipschitz continuous,which is less conservative and less restrictive than much of previous research.Secondly, we obtained a sufficient condition ensuring the existence and unique-ness of the equilibrium point of general BAM neural networks with delays by using topological degree theory,and we also have a sufficient condition ensuring the global exponential stability of general BAM neural networks with delays by constructing a Lyapunov functional.Thirdly, by using topological degree theory and M-matrix theory,we obtained another sufficient conditions ensuring the existence and uniqueness of the equi-librium point of general BAM neural networks with delays,and by constructing a Lyapunov-Krasovskii functional we have a sufficient conditions ensuring the global asymptotic stability of general BAM neural networks with delays.Fourthly, by constructing a homeomorphism map,a proper Lyapunov-Krasovskii functional,and by using the properties of M-matrix, we discuss the global asymp-totic stability of general BAM neural networks with delays while the parameters float at intervals,and the continuity of equilibrium point which dependent on the parameters of the system is also investigated.At last, numerical simulation is given to support the obtained results in the back of each chapter.
